- 博客(35)
- 资源 (5)
- 收藏
- 关注
原创 如何定义 Java 中的方法(二)
如何定义 Java 中的方法(一) 有时方法的执行需要依赖于某些条件,换句话说,要想通过方法完成特定的功能,需要为其提供额外的信息才行。例如,现实生活中电饭锅可以实现“煮饭”的功能,但前提是我们必须提供食材,如果我们什么都不提供,那就真是的“巧妇难为无米之炊”了。我们可以通过在方法中加入参数列表接收外部传入的数据信息,参数可以是任意的基本类型数据或引用类型数据。我们先来看一个带参数,但没有返回
2016-05-07 22:02:33
1278
原创 Java中的方法
如何定义 Java 中的方法(一) 所谓方法,就是用来解决一类问题的代码的有序组合,是一个功能模块。一般情况下,定义一个方法的语法是:其中:1、 访问修饰符:方法允许被访问的权限范围, 可以是 public、protected、private 甚至可以省略 ,其中 public 表示该方法可以被其他任何代码调用,其他几种修饰符的使用在后面章节中会详细讲解滴2、 返回值类型:方法返回值的类型,如
2016-05-06 17:41:16
849
原创 String 比较
Java 里面String 是不能用“==”或“!=”比较的,要用equal() 所以 把!= 改成 equals()!=true
2016-03-12 20:33:18
407
原创 zigbee 基础知识
FFD Full Function Device 全功能设备 RFD Reduced Function Device 精简功能设备 FFD 可以当做一个网络协调器或者一个普通的协调器节点,它可以和任何其他设备进行通讯,传递有RFD发来的数据到其他设备,即充当了路由的功能,而RFD 只能是传感器节点,他只能和FFD进行通讯,经过FFD可以将测得的数据传送出去。
2016-03-12 19:43:39
674
原创 认识UART接口
串口进行通信的方式有两种:同步通信方式和异步通信方式SPI(Serial Peripheral Interface:串行外设接口); I2C(INTER IC BUS:意为IC之间总线),一(host)对多,以字节为单位发送。 UART(Universal Asynchronous Receiver Transmitter:通用异步收发器), 一对一,以位为单位发送。 一般uart控制器在嵌入
2016-03-06 17:51:14
4824
原创 关于git初始化后无 .git文件生成的问题
其实在你初始化完成以后, .git文件夹已生成,只是设置成了隐藏选项。 选择文件选项 然后选择显示隐藏的文件即可。
2016-03-02 22:03:58
1313
转载 navicat快捷方法
navicat 结合快捷键 1.ctrl+q 打开查询窗口 2.ctrl+/ 注释sql语句 3.ctrl+shift +/ 解除注释 4.ctrl+r 运行查询窗口的sql语句 5.ctrl+shift+r 只运行选中的sql语句 6.F6 打开一个mysql命令行窗口 7.ctrl+l
2016-02-29 22:03:24
474
转载 ]Android ADT SDK API 说明
(引用,转载请注明出处: http://blog.youkuaiyun.com/luzhenrong45/article/details/9263791 ) 一. Android ADT:按照官方网站的开发介绍:Android Development Tools (ADT) is a plugin for the Eclipse IDE that is designed to give you
2016-02-25 12:52:57
393
转载 java中for-each用法小结
package rholiday;import java.util.Arrays;import java.util.Arrays;public class HelloWorld { public static void main(String[] args) { // 创建对象,对象名为hello HelloWorld hello = new HelloWorl
2016-02-25 10:52:49
838
转载 Android中自定义Adapter的基本原理
第一种:匿名内部类作为事件监听器类 大部分时候,事件处理器都没有什么利用价值(可利用代码通常都被抽象成了业务逻辑方法),因此大部分事件监听器只是临时使用一次,所以使用匿名内部类形式的事件监听器更合适,实际上,这种形式是目前是最广泛的事件监听器形式。上面的程序代码就是匿名内部类来创建事件监听器的!!!对于使用匿名内部类作为监听器的形式来说,唯一的缺点就是匿名内部类的语法有点不易掌握,如果
2015-10-12 21:09:58
482
转载 StringBuffer的用法
在使用StringBuffer 的时候,习惯性的像String一样把他初始化为了 StringBuffer result = null; 结果警告:Null pointer access: The variable result can only be null at this location 运行后报错,才意识到StringBuffer和String还是有很多区别的,摆渡了些资料整理出来,
2015-09-13 11:39:06
483
转载 android application 收集所有avtivity
个人笔记: 通用 application 1、收集所有 avtivity 用于彻底退出应用 2、捕获崩溃异常,保存错误日志,并重启应用 public class HKBaseApplication extends Application { // activity对象列表,用于activity统一管理 private List activityL
2015-08-22 21:52:05
556
原创 设置TextView居于屏幕底部的方法
目前使用过两种方法第一种:使用RelativeLayout <LinearLayout android:id="@+id/linearLayout03" android:layout_width="match_parent" android:layout_height="wrap_content" android:orien
2015-06-24 20:47:53
8700
原创 eclipse Failed to create the part's controls 解决方法
jsp文件直接拷贝到的工程里可能会出现上述问题,这可能是eleclipse本身的bug,,重新启动eclipse即可。
2015-06-05 16:27:23
905
原创 The JSP specification requires that an attribute name is preceded by whitespace
服务部署调试时出现这样的错误The JSP specification requires that an attribute name is preceded by whitespace经过查找发现是提示的modify_admin.jsp中 begin="1" end="3"> begin前面少了个空格所致。看来空格在jsp中很重要啊切记!!!!!!!
2015-05-30 18:02:25
731
原创 关于中文乱码的解决方法
客户端与服务器端在进行交互时,不可避免的要遇到中文乱码的情况,为什么呢,因为这些事老外发明的,一开始或许压根就没考虑中文。所以后来我们就自己发明了转码,将英文字符转换为我们能懂常用文字,哈哈,以上这些胡扯的不用当真。下面就介绍我自己的解决中文乱码的方法吧。1.数据库存储中文乱码我用的是MYSQL,需要将数据库的url后面加上useUnicode=true&characterEncoding
2015-05-13 10:16:16
3430
原创 怎么让Linearlayout里面的textview垂直居中
<LinearLayout android:layout_width="wrap_content" android:layout_height="40dp" android:orientation="vertical" android:layout_weight="1" android:gravity="center
2015-05-09 21:03:20
4974
转载 Android工程导入中文乱码
修改单个工程的编码方式:右击工程,在弹出的菜单中选择最后一项“Properties”在打开的新窗口左边的菜单树中选择 Info(即第一个),然后在右面找到 Text file encoding ,选择 “other”,在下拉框中选择utf-8编码方式即可。原文地址:http://blog.youkuaiyun.com/xsl1990/article/detail
2015-05-04 16:35:28
501
转载 自定义ListView中的分割线
原文作者 http://blog.youkuaiyun.com/zuolongsnail/article/details/7187302ListView中每个Item项之间都有分割线,设置android:footerDividersEnabled表示是否显示分割线,此属性默认为true。1.不显示分割线只要在ListView控件中添加android:footerDividersEn
2015-03-29 20:50:45
480
原创 java.lang.NoClassDefFoundError: org.achartengine.renderer.XYMultipleSeriesRenderer解决方法
最近写安卓软件碰到一个头疼,问题,看了网上的各种方法仍然没有解决,甚是苦恼,当晚就不准备干了,第二天一大早对比了以前的程序才恍然大悟原来某个文件夹下少了东西。不好描述直接上图吧。问题 java.lang.NoClassDefFoundError: org.achartengine.renderer.XYMultipleSeriesRenderer网上解决方法:在到导入achart
2015-03-28 10:42:06
522
原创 layout_marginBottom的使用
使用android:layout_marginBottom时,必须将android:layout_alignParentBottom设为true,另外单位最好用dp
2015-03-27 01:40:03
920
转载 百度APIKey申请
申请密钥Android SDK简介申请步骤简介在使用百度地图SDK为您提供的各种LBS能力之前,您需要获取百度地图移动版的开发密钥,该密钥与您的百度账户相关联。因此,您必须先有百度帐户,才能获得开发密钥。并且,该密钥与您创建的过程名称有关,具体流程请参考如下介绍。Key的申请地址为:http://lbsyun.baidu.com/apiconso
2015-03-23 17:41:29
13643
原创 空指针异常 java.lang.NullPointerException
空指针异常:两个方面(1)该控件不在当前界面加载的布局文件中。 请确认某控件是否layout文件布局中。(2)开发工具问题,选中该工程,执行菜单Project->clean,重启Eclipse开发工具,再次执行看看是否正常。R文件丢失也与布局有关
2015-03-23 17:38:02
666
转载 Eclipse导入项目:No projects are found to import
1 http://www.ztyhome.com/android-import-error/(网址不稳定详细内容如下:)2 如果发现导入工程(impot)的时候,出现”No projects are found to import” 的提示,首先查看项目目录中是否有隐藏文件.project,还有目录结构也还要有一个隐藏文件.classpath,如果没有,你可以参考一下方法方
2015-03-13 16:47:05
566
1
转载 java中的File.separator
问题:上传的图片不能正确显示。我的开发环境是在Windows下,工程在Windows下能正常部署,上传的图片也可以正常的显示。但是把工程部署在服务器上的时候,图片总是不能显示,很是让人郁闷,后来在网上找了各种资料,问题终于解决了。文件路径的分隔符在windows系统和linux系统中是不一样。比如说要在temp目录下建立一个test.txt文件,在Windo
2015-02-05 14:34:49
395
原创 退出整个应用程序 以及 利用intent标志跳转到某个Activity
我们在写android应用程序时,经常会遇到想退出当前Acitivity,或者直接退出应用程序.我之前的一般操作是按返回键,或者直接按home键直接返回,其实这两种操作都没有关闭当前应用程序,没有释放系统资源。有时跳转的activity较多时,还需要多次按返回键,这样感觉一点都不爽。后面添加了一个菜单返回功能键,这个方法也只能用system.exit(0)来关闭当前活动的Activity,
2015-01-31 22:25:42
655
转载 Android:Layout_weight的深刻理解
最近写Demo,突然发现了Layout_weight这个属性,发现网上有很多关于这个属性的有意思的讨论,可是找了好多资料都没有找到一个能够说的清楚的,于是自己结合网上资料研究了一下,终于迎刃而解,写出来和大家分享。首先看一下Layout_weight属性的作用:它是用来分配属于空间的一个属性,你可以设置他的权重。很多人不知道剩余空间是个什么概念,下面我先来说说剩余空间。看下面代码:
2015-01-25 17:24:18
430
原创 Fragment 总结
最近学到fragment,觉得这真是一个好东西,非常实用。现总结如下:还是直接用实例说话吧,文笔不好,自己的心得。需要两个fragment布局,一个主布局main。两个fragment布局对应两个继承Fragment的类,一个主布局对应一个主类MainActivity主布局内需要加入两个fragment布局。代码如下:<RelativeLayout xmlns:android=
2015-01-18 11:47:49
740
原创 相对布局中需要特别记忆的几个属性
相对布局是经常用到的布局,其中有几个布局是我经常忽略的,特此记录一下:1.将控件垂直居中android:layout_centerVertical 如果为true,将该控件的置于垂直居中; 2 android:layout_toLeftOf 将该控件的右边缘与给定ID的控件左边缘对齐; 3 android:layout_toRightOf 将该控件的左边缘与给定ID的控件右边缘对齐
2015-01-17 22:29:58
432
原创 'android.R.id.list'异常
使用listview应注意两点:1 类若继承的是Activity,,则布局文件中listview的id可自主命名。如下<ListView android:id="@+id/ListView01" android:layout_width="wrap_content" android:layout_height="wr
2015-01-17 22:16:09
613
转载 灵活使用XMultipleSeriesRenderer设置自定义的轴标签
ACE绘制的图形,坐标轴上的刻度值,要么显示为数字,要么显示为时间:那么能不能在坐标轴上显示自己的内容,比如文字呢?这需要使用 XYMultipleSeriesRenderer的addTextLabel(int,String)方法。该方法接收一个int参数,用于指定要显示文字的X轴坐标,比如在X轴坐标1的位置显示“昆明”,则addTextLabel(1,”昆
2015-01-12 21:19:48
544
转载 如何将TextView内容放到屏幕正中间
设置textview属性中重要的两个为 layout_weight 和 gravity layout_weight表示一个组件在其父组件中的所占的比重和地位。它的属性比较复杂。分为两种情况,当layout_width=“fill_parent”时,值越小比重越大。layout_width=“wrap_content”时,值越大所占比重越大。具体情况可以看看这篇文章http://mob
2015-01-08 17:37:26
7170
原创 利用Achartengine制作折线图
最近在学安卓开发,需要在Activity中显示一个折线图,Achartengine是一款很好的制图工具,可以用来绘制折线图,柱状图、圆饼图等。原理很简单。经过两天的摸索算是基本掌握了一些使用方法,现把自己的心得总结一下。小弟初次写博客,写的不好的话,请各位批评指正。先上效果图吧代码如下import org.achartengine.ChartFactory;import org.acha
2015-01-03 14:58:08
768
JRT 0164-2018安全应用技术规范.zip
2020-05-07
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人